“Against My Will” Project

In commemoration of sexual assault awareness month, Artist Traci Molloy has collaborated with Castleton students, faculty, and staff to anonymously share stories of sexual harassment and assault. Molloy hopes to bring awareness to the seriousness of these experiences. Traci Molloy is a Brooklyn-based artist, collaborator, and educator. Molloy creates large-scale, multi-media collaborations with young adults across the nation who have experienced trauma. Five of her collaborations with young adults are in the Permanent Collection at the National September 11th Memorial and Museum. *Sponsored by the Vermont State University Center for Social Justice and Trauma-Informed Care and the Bowse Health Trust*

The National Audubon Photography Show of 2022

The Rutland County Audubon Society is hosting an exhibit of the winning photographs of the 2022 National Audubon Photography Contest! The large format images are being displayed at the VTSU Castleton Bank Gallery on the corner of Merchants Row and Center Street in Rutland, March 22nd-April 27th. The stunning winners were selected from 10,000 photos and videos submitted by almost 2,500 photographers. The exhibit will be available for viewing every Thursday, Friday, Saturday from 12:00- 6:00 pm. All are welcome; admission is free! *Photo courtesy of The National Audubon Society | https://www.audubon.org/news/audubon-announces-2022-audubon-photography-awards-winners
